Electrode sheet structure of battery cell, and battery cell and battery

By creating thinning recesses and tab grooves on the surface of the active material layer of the lithium-ion battery, the problem of lithium plating under high-rate charging is solved, improving the safety and stability of the battery and maintaining its energy density.

Abstract

An electrode sheet structure of a battery cell, and a battery cell and a battery, which belong to the technical field of batteries. The electrode sheet structure of a battery cell comprises a current collector (1) and an active material layer (2) connected to at least one surface of the current collector (1), wherein the surface of the active material layer (2) in the direction of width is provided with at least one thinned recess (3); the active material layer (2) is further provided with a tab groove (4); the tab groove (4) penetrates in the direction of thickness of the active material layer (2); the tab groove (4) is used for the mounting of a tab (5); and the bottom of the tab groove (4) extends to the surface of the current collector (1). The structure can reduce the occurrence probability of lithium plating in some regions where lithium ions are present, thereby improving the safety and stability of the structure during use, and ensuring the energy density thereof.

[0002] Lithium ion battery is a kind of secondary battery, because it has energy density, self-discharge rate is low, potential difference is high, cycle life is long and many advantages, is widely used in consumer electronics, new energy vehicles, energy storage devices and other technical fields. With the continuous iteration of technology, consumer electronics and other lithium batteries cycle life and fast charging ability requirement is higher and higher, to meet customer demand, lithium battery charging and discharging times and charging rate are bigger and bigger.

[0003] However, in the process of high-rate charging, the current density on the surface unit area of the electrode tab is high, that is, the lithium ion concentration is high, which can easily cause lithium precipitation in some areas of the electric core, resulting in performance failure of the electric core and reducing its safety and stability in use.

[0038] As shown in Figure 1, in an embodiment of the utility model, the cell pole piece structure;Including current collector 1 and the active material layer 2 connected to at least one surface of current collector 1;The surface of active material layer 2 along the width direction is provided with at least one thinning recess 3;Active material layer 2 is also provided with tab groove 4;Tab groove 4 is provided along the thickness direction of active material layer 2;Tab groove 4 is used for installing tab 5;And the bottom of tab groove 4 extends to the surface of current collector 1 setting. As shown in Figure 1, the width direction is Y axis direction, that is, the direction perpendicular to the coated active material layer 2;The thickness direction is Z axis direction.

[0039] The technical scheme of the utility model discloses a technology scheme that adds one or more thinning recesses on the surface of the active material layer to form a thinning area on the surface of the coating area, thereby effectively reducing the lithium ion discharge amount of the partial area of the pole piece and reducing the probability of lithium precipitation in the partial area of the lithium ion, further improving the safety and stability of the structure in use and guaranteeing the energy density thereof; in addition, the thinning recess is further provided on the active material layer to effectively guarantee the installation of the tab and reduce the lithium ion discharge amount of the partial area of the pole piece, thereby reducing the mutual interference of the two functions and improving the safety and stability in use and guaranteeing the energy density thereof.

[0040] In some embodiments, the active material of the active material layer 2 is one of lithium cobaltate, lithium iron phosphate, lithium manganate, lithium nickel cobalt manganate and lithium nickel cobalt aluminum.

[0041] Specifically, in some embodiments, as shown in FIGS. 1 and 2, the thinning recess 3 includes at least one first recess 31; the first recess 31 is arranged in parallel to the width direction of the active material layer 2; and the first recess 31 is arranged through the width direction of the active material layer 2. That is, as shown in FIG. 2, the thinning length of the first recess 31 is the width of the pole piece; and a plurality of first recesses 31 are arranged in parallel along the length direction of the active material layer 2 (the length direction is the X-axis direction, i.e., the direction parallel to the coating direction). The structure can effectively reduce the discharge amount of lithium ions in the charging process through the guiding action of the plurality of first recesses 31, thereby improving the lithium precipitation problem of the lithium ion battery in high-rate charging and discharging and achieving the effect of improving the safety of the battery.

[0042] Specifically, in some embodiments, as shown in FIGS. 1 and 2, when the cell pole piece structure is in a wound state, the first recess 31 is arranged at the corner position 6; and / or, at most part of the first recess 31 is arranged at the straight position 7. That is, after the cell pole piece structure is wound into a bare cell, the thinning recess 3 can be exactly arranged in the corner area of the corner position 6 of the bare cell. The thinning recess 3 can also be mostly arranged in the corner area of the bare cell and a small part extends to the straight area of the straight position 7, so as to increase the lithium ion guiding action of the corner, thereby improving the corner lithium precipitation problem of the lithium ion battery in high-rate charging and discharging and achieving the effect of improving the safety of the battery.

[0043] Specifically, in some embodiments, as shown in FIGS. 2 and 3, the relationship between the thickness H2 of the first recess 31 and the thickness H1 of the electrode tab structure satisfies: H2 = H1 * A; wherein A = (8% ~ 14%). After the current collector 1 is completely coated with the active material layer 2, the laser cleaning equipment performs face width thinning on the active material layer 2. The thinning thickness is set in a gradient of 8%, 10%, 12%, 14%, etc. of the roll-pressed thickness of the electrode tab structure, forming a thinning area, and then the electrode tab structure is obtained after slitting. This structure can achieve a CB value of the thinning area that is larger than that of the non-thinning area, thereby better improving the lithium precipitation phenomenon. If the thickness H2 of the first recess 31 is too large, the CB value will be too large, which will lead to an increase in the oxidation state of the tab and thus increase the safety hazard. If the thickness H2 of the first recess 31 is too small, the effect of improving lithium precipitation cannot be achieved.

[0044] Specifically, in some embodiments, as shown in FIGS. 1 and 4, the thinning recess 3 further comprises at least one second recess 32; the second recess 32 is arranged on at least one side of the width direction of the active material layer 2; and the second recess 32 abuts against the edge of the width direction of the active material layer 2. As shown in FIG. 4, the second recess 32 is symmetrically arranged on both sides of the width direction of the active material layer 2 and is arranged through the length direction of the active material layer 2. That is, this structure can increase the lithium ion guiding and aggregation of the corner by arranging the second recess 32 as a thinning area at the edge, effectively reduce the lithium ion release amount of the positive electrode tab partial area, reduce the occurrence of lithium precipitation at the edge of the lithium ion battery, and achieve the effect of improving the safety of the battery; and in combination with the first recess 31, the occurrence of lithium precipitation at the edge and corner of the lithium ion battery can be reduced, and the effect of improving the safety of the battery can be achieved.

[0045] Specifically, in some embodiments, as shown in FIG. 4, the width L1 of the second recess 32 satisfies: L1 = 5 ~ 10 mm. Wherein L1 can be 5 mm, 6 mm, 7 mm, 8 mm, 9 mm and 10 mm, etc. This structure can effectively reduce the lithium ion release amount of the positive electrode tab partial area, reduce the occurrence of lithium precipitation at the edge of the lithium ion battery, and achieve the effect of improving the safety of the battery by the second recess 32 with a reasonable width value.

[0046] Specifically, in some embodiments, as shown in FIG. 5, the relationship between the thickness H3 of the second recess 32 and the thickness H1 of the electrode tab structure satisfies: H3 = H1 * B; wherein B = (8%~14%). After the current collector 1 is completely coated with the active material layer 2, the laser cleaning equipment performs face width thinning on the active material layer 2. The thinning thickness is set in a gradient of 8%, 10%, 12%, 14%, etc. of the roll-pressed thickness of the electrode tab structure to form a thinning area, and then the electrode tab structure is obtained after slitting. The CB value of the thinning area is larger than that of the non-thinning area, so as to better improve the lithium precipitation phenomenon. When the thickness H3 of the second recess 32 is too large, the CB value will be too large; thus, the oxidation state of the tab will be increased, which will increase the safety hazard. When the thickness H3 of the second recess 32 is too small, the effect of improving lithium precipitation cannot be achieved.

[0047] Wherein, as shown in FIGS. 1 and 2, the tab 5 is welded to the current collector 1; and the tab recess 4 is further provided with a protective layer 51; the protective layer 51 is connected to the tab 5; and the projection of the protective layer 51 towards the current collector 1 covers the part of the tab 5 located in the tab recess 4. Wherein, the protective layer 51 is an adhesive. That is to say, in order to ensure the assembly stability and overall packaging of the tab 5, the protective layer 51 with a larger coverage area is used to package and protect the tab 5, so as to improve the safety and stability in use. As shown in FIG. 4, the relationship between the length D2 of the protective layer 51 and the length D1 of the tab 5 satisfies: D2-D1≥1mm.

[0055] Example 1

[0056] The laser cleaning equipment is used to thin the surface of the cathode sheet to form a thinning recess 3. The thinning thickness of the thinning recess 3 is set according to 8% of the rolling thickness of the cell tab structure, and then the corresponding cathode sheet is obtained after slitting.

[0057] Then the lithium ion cell (battery) containing the above-mentioned cathode sheet is placed in a 25℃ constant temperature room, and is placed for 10 minutes. It is charged to 4.50V at 2.8C constant current, and then charged to 0.05C at 4.50V constant voltage. Then it is discharged to 3.0V at 1.0C constant current. This is one charge and discharge cycle. Repeat the charging and discharging, and observe the lithium precipitation window interface of the lithium ion cell (battery) after 20 cycles.

[0079] Among them, the lithium precipitation level is marked as A < B < C in turn from slight to severe.

[0080] As can be seen from the table:

[0081] 1. When the thinning thickness of the thinning recess 3 is controlled according to 10% of the rolling thickness of the cell pole piece structure, the pole piece corner can be effectively improved for lithium precipitation. In addition, the thinning recess width and the cell thickness are controlled within a reasonable range:

[0082] When K / T=2 / 3pi, as in Example 5, the core thickness is uniform, the outermost coil is wound corresponding to the width K of the thinning recess T*2pi / 3, the overall corner area is wound relatively loose, more electrolyte is stored, but the lithium ion transmission path is lengthened, and thus the lithium precipitation improvement effect is poorer than that of Example K=pi / 2*T;

[0083] When K / T=pi / 3, as in Example 6, when the outermost coil is wound corresponding to the width K of the thinning recess T*1pi / 3, the overall corner area is wound relatively tight, although the lithium ion transmission path is shortened, but the local area electrolyte storage is less, and as the cycle proceeds, the electrolyte consumption increases, and thus causes the lithium precipitation to be aggravated;

[0084] Therefore, it is preferred that K / T=pi / 2, as in Example 2, at this time the bare core winding yield is optimal, and the lithium precipitation improvement effect is optimal.

[0085] 2. When the cathode sheet edge or corner is not thinned, at 2.8C charge rate, lithium ions are completely removed, causing serious local lithium precipitation of the sheet, and further affecting the performance.

[0086] 3. When the thinning value is too high, the CB value is too large, the local positive electrode oxidation state is increased, causing the interface to appear purple spots, and thus the lithium precipitation is aggravated;

[0087] 4. According to the corresponding parameters (as shown in Example 5, T=5mm, K=2.5pi mm, at this time K / T=pi / 2), a laser cleaning device is used to clean the lithium precipitation of the sheet, so as to improve the lithium precipitation of the cell and improve the safety of the battery.
